After graduating from Dalhousie University, Matt Cohen (BComm’07) started his career in New York on Wall street working for RBC Capital Markets, covering global hedge funds.

While working at RBC Cohen helped start Turnstyle Analytics, a wifi-marketing company. Writing the first cheque to get the company off the ground, Cohen saw it eventually grow to a team of 45 employees. Turnstyle, now known as Yelp Wi-Fi, was acquired by crowd-sourced review website, Yelp, last year for around $20 million.”
